How to change the basin of Chlorophytum

In order to change the pot of Chlorophytum, the soil with strong air permeability should be prepared first, and the diseased root, old root and dead root of the plant should be pruned off after removing the pot. If the root system is large, the plant can be divided. After treatment, it shall be spread to the basin soil, covered with soil and compacted, and then placed in a cool place for curing after watering. In addition, the flowerpot is best used after disinfection and sterilization.

How to change

1. Preparation of potted soil: do not use simple garden soil when preparing potted soil. It is recommended to mix humus soil, river sand, etc. this kind of soil has sufficient nutrition supply and good air permeability, which is very suitable for the growth of Chlorophytum.

2. Pruning root system: when changing basin, the root system of Chlorophytum should be pruned properly, and the diseased root, dead root and old root should be pruned. If the root system of Chlorophytum is too large, it can be divided into several plants.

3. Upper basin maintenance: spread out the root system of Chlorophytum, cover the soil and compact it, and finally cover the outer layer with a layer of soil without compaction, then pour it through with water and put it in a cool place for maintenance..

2. Precautions

When changing pots, you should prepare a pot that is one size larger than the original one, and you'd better disinfect the pot. After changing the basin, put it in a bright and ventilated place to avoid the strong sunlight
